open-network-insight
Open Network Insight is an open source solution for packet and flow analytics on Hadoop. It provides ingest and transform of binary data, scalable machine learning, and interactive visualization for identifying threats in network flows and DNS packets. Open Network Insight uses the open source projects Jupyter, nfdump, wireshark, and D3.

redis
Redis is an in-memory database that persists on disk. The data model is key-value, but many different kind of values are supported: Strings, Lists, Sets, Sorted Sets, Hashes, HyperLogLogs, Bitmaps.
